Mandya has 14.2 bank branches per lakh population, better than the typical district. The district's credit-deposit ratio is 165.1, better than the typical district. Every branch here is a physical point of access to savings and credit.
78% of registered enterprises are in services while 22% are in manufacturing. Only 3% of employment is in small and medium enterprises. Only 54% of school-age children are enrolled in higher secondary school (classes 9–12). Only 42% of ITI trainers are certified.
In Mandya, which ranks 15 of 31 in Karnataka for youth opportunity, the overall opportunity score is 48.5 out of 100. It runs ahead of the national picture on credit going to productive use at 71.2% and women with a bank account at 95.1%. On small-business loans per lakh people at ₹58,701, it sits close to the national mark. The district has 60,335 registered enterprises.
